Tockwith Rd 2
This race was a cat 3/4 on a closed circuit at Tockwith aerodrome near Wetherby, the race stated out steady with a few early breaks but the breaks kept getting pulled back so I just sat mid pack waiting for a development. 4 laps to go I moved to the top quarter to watch any breaks and just to see what the peloton mood was, 2 laps to go I went to the front with Hendry and Armistead on my wheel, we increased the pace and started to string out the group and things were going to plan. The last lap caused a little panic as we were pulling away so they pulled us back which meant a fast left hand corner sprint to the line. We all made it safely through the corner and then it was a mass sprint. I carried good speed out of the corner and managed to hold on for 4th.

Tockwith rd 3 & Huddersfield Sunday road club
Tuesday was the venue for the last Tockwith circuit race this season held on the aerodrome near Wetherby. The race started off at a quick pace but then slowly came back together as it was 25 laps long. I rode at the front of the pack most of the evening with fellow team mates helping Ady Rudd to stay away until the last lap, a great team effort by all I just missed out of the sprint due to losing a line.
Huddersfield Sunday road race was ridden in the strongest wind this summer, with a rolling course the riders began to drop out one by one, I had to work hard for a lap to fight my way back into the pack but job well done finished in the main sprint group with Ady & Billy.
